What documents and process are required for court marriage registration?

I am an Indian citizen, and I want to do a court marriage in India with my Nepali partner. We are already married, but we did not register our marriage in Nepal or any court in Nepal. I want to register our marriage in India, specifically in Bhopal, as it is my birthplace. I would like to know the required documents for a court marriage, how many days the process takes, the applicable charges, and if there are any additional legal formalities for an Indian-Nepali marriage. Do we need any special permissions or affidavits due to my spouse’s foreign nationality? Will my spouse require a visa or any other legal documentation, and is there a waiting period after submitting the application? Please provide detailed information regarding the process.

To register your marriage in Bhopal under the Special Marriage Act, submit a notice to the Marriage Registrar with documents like identity proof, age proof, passport size photos and an affidavit. After a 30-day waiting period, if no objections are raised, you can complete the registration. Charges are minimal, and your Nepali spouse does not need a visa.
